Summary

As an Optics Technician, you will assemble optical beams and optical assemblies, perform optical alignment, calibration and verification testing for optical subassemblies and finished instruments in accordance with manufacturing documentation (assembly instructions, process documents, etc.) using a variety of hand tools, measuring devices and test equipment.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Own the production queue across optical subassembly build, alignment, end-of-line verification, and documentation review.
  • Assemble optical beams and assemblies (per drawings, job travelers, and work instructions (WIs).
  • Install and align optical components to meet acceptance criteria using alignment fixtures and optical test equipment (e.g., power meters, microscopes) and documented procedures
  • Execute instrument calibration at build and test stations; perform re-alignment of optic assemblies if required.
  • Evaluate data vs. acceptance criteria and flag out-of-spec results; partner with engineering on troubleshooting, root-cause analysis, and corrective actions (rework plans, containment, prevention).
  • Review and sign off on manufacturing records, job travelers, and alignment logs; ensure objective evidence is complete and traceable.
  • Own cleaning and preventive maintenance routines for optical benches/test fixtures and production equipment to maintain repeatability and throughput.
  • Partner with operations and engineers to improve WIs and visual standards (fixtures, checklists, go/no-go criteria, data review templates) to drive yield and reduce variation.
  • Operate under ISO9001 expectations and support audits by providing objective evidence and clear traceability.
  • Other duties as assigned.
